"I DON'T KNOW WHAT TO WEAR," I said with a sigh.

"To your date or to lunch with your mother and sister?" Anna asked me as she shut her textbook.

I FaceTimed her on my laptop because we haven't talked in a while. She was studying for her math exam she has in two days. After that, she gets to come back to Midville for Thanksgiving break.

"To both," I answered, honestly, as I pulled out a bright purple dress.

"Definitely not that. That needs to go back in the closet and never come out again," Anna said, shuddering at the dress.

I put it back in the closet, and I found a cute black top. I showed it to Anna, who nodded approvingly.

"Wear that with dark blue jeans," Anna added, making me grab a pair of dark blue jeans.

"You need to find a jacket or something to go with it," Anna said after I changed into the outfit in my closet.

"Hold on, let me look at what I got," I said, scanning through my different jackets. I found a cute white bomber jacket with two black strips at the bottom. I showed Anna who smiled.

"Put it on, and let's see," Anna told me before opening a bag a chips. I put the jacket on, and she squealed.

"It's so cute," Anna complimented.

"I'm going to wear this for lunch then change into a dress or something for my date," I said, looking at myself in the mirror.

"Okay. Oh crap, I gotta go. I'm meeting my study group for the exam."

"Alright. I'll talk to you later. Bye."

Anna ended the call, and I shut my computer. I walked back into my closet to find a cute but warm dress for tonight.

As I was looking for a dress, Lisa yelled,"Campbell! Come on, we gotta get going!"

I walked out of my closet before grabbing my phone and wallet. I walked out of my room, shutting the door behind me. Lisa was waiting for me by the front door with Summer beside her.

Summer had to go to the vet for an annual checkup so Lisa is going to drop me off at the restaurant I'm suppose to meet Grace and Leah.

"You look cute," Lisa said, admiring my outfit.

"Thank you. You do too."

She smiled,"Come on, let's get going."

We walked out of the house, and to the car. Lisa put Summer in the back while I climbed into the passenger seat.

Lisa got into the driver's seat before starting the engine. She backed out of the driveway, and we were on our way.

"Are you nervous?" Lisa asked me, glancing over at me.
